Abstract

Sodium-fluorescein was injected intravenously in human beings, and the concentration of fluorescein in the anterior chamber of normal eyes was measured and compared with the blood concentration of the ultrafiltrable part of fluorescein. When the concentration in the anterior chamber is highest it is about one tenth of the blood concentration of the diffusible fluorescein at the same time. Therefore the aqueous humour cannot be formed by ultrafiltration. By means of a mathematical analysis it is possible to evaluate the output of the human aqueous humour per minute from our measurements. It is 2 mm3 per minute.
